Volunteer Items.

The members of the Manchester Rifles are rernineled that Lieut.-Col. Ncwall will inspect the corps on Thursday next. Haversacks will he issued to those men who attend the Easter Encampment. Lieut. Burlacc has presented the company with a very handsome bugle. Yesterday afternoon a few members of the A Class of the Manchester Rifles had some practice with tho MartiniHenri rifles. Vol Scott made 57, 27 at f>oo and 30 at (300 ; Sergt F. Say well 54, 31 and 23 ; Vol Saywell 52, 28 and 24 ; Licnt Bray 48, 26 and 22. Vol Scott and Scrgt Saywell will be the only representatives of the Manchester Rifles at the New Zealand Rifle Association Meeting next month. They will leave Foildiug on Monday next.
